Kickback safety rules
Kickback may occur when the nose or tip of the guide bar touches an object
or when the material closes in and pinches the chain while cutting. These
conditions may cause sudden reverse reactions with a consequent loss of
control of the electric saw.
The understanding and prevention of kickback eliminate the element of
surprise reducing the possibility of an accident. To avoid and reduce
kickback, keep the electric saw under control by grasping it with both hands.
Make sure that the area where you are cutting is free from obstacles.
Cutting walls
The most delicate phase of wall level cutting is the saw penetration which has to be
done slowly and always at an angle of 35° (see Fig. 13-13). After a diagonal cutting of
about 30 - 40 cm, set the electric saw at 90° and execute in this position a through-
cutting of the wall (see Fig. 13-13A).
Figure 13 How to make horizontal cuts.
Never push down on the saw when cutting. The weight of the saw alone enables it to
cut properly with minimum effort.
